Single Serve Gluten Free Plum Cake

This gluten free single serving plum cake is the perfect seasonal dessert when you need a little sweet treat without the fuss of baking a whole cake. Dairy free and refined sugar free, this is the healthiest cake you'll eat!

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ings 1 serving
Author Victoria Faling

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oon melted butter or coconut oil*
  • 2 tablespoon coconut sugar plus more for topping
  • 1 egg
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 tablespoon milk of choice
  • ¼ cup 1:1 gluten free flour
  • ¼ teaspoon baking powder
  • teaspoon cinnamon
  • pinch of salt
  • 1 plum cut in half and pitted

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350 F. Grease a ramekin and set aside.
  • Whisk together the oil/butter and coconut sugar then add in the egg, vanilla, and milk and whisk until smooth.
  • Add all the dry ingredients and mix until combined.
  • Pour batter into a greased ramekin and press 2 halves of your plum, cut side up, into the batter.
  • Sprinkle with coconut sugar and bake on a baking sheet for 20-25 minutes until a toothpick comes out clean.
  • Let cool and enjoy!

Notes

*I have not tested olive oil, but I think it could work.
